Alla vet att Excel är ett kraftfullt kalkylblad och att Google Sheets är den online molnbaserade Excel-wannabe - men vet du vad XML är? XML står för Extensible Markup Language och det är ett filformat som blir oerhört populärt eftersom det är interoperabelt och kompatibelt med många programvarupaket. En fil som är sparad som XML bör kunna öppnas i ursprungsläge av all programvara som stöder XML-filtypen. I själva verket använder kontorssviter som Microsoft Office och LibreOffice nu XML-filer som deras standardsparaformat, en enorm förbättring under dagarna med proprietära spara filer som du måste ha en betald licens för att få åtkomst till. XML är ett i huvudsak textbaserat filformat som du kan redigera med textredigerare, och det har ett antal andra fördelar jämfört med andra format. Till exempel är det ett mycket mer kompakt format än andra alternativ, och det är noderstrukturen mellan föräldrar och barn som gör lagring av strukturerad information både mycket effektiv och lättläst.
Se även vår artikel Hur man länkar data till en annan flik i Google Sheets
En av de största nackdelarna med Google Sheets är att det trots dess kraft och användarvänlighet inte innehåller något inbyggt alternativ som du kan exportera kalkylark direkt till XML-format. Om du klickar på Arkiv > Ladda ner som i Google Sheets kan du ladda ner och spara kalkylarken med format som visas i ögonblicksbilden direkt nedan. De tillgängliga formaten inkluderar ODS, PDF, HTML och CSV, men inte XML. Det närmaste till XML finns Excel XLSX, som är Microsoft Office: s öppna XML-format för kalkylblad.
En metod är att ladda ner kalkylarket i ett av dessa format och sedan konvertera det till XML. Det finns några mjukvarupaket och webbverktyg som gör att du kan konvertera PDF-filer till XML-format. PDF till XML OCR Converter, NitroPDF och PDF2XML är några av programvarupaketen du kan konvertera PDF till XML med. Du kan till och med använda en webbaserad omvandlare för att undvika att behöva ladda ner programvara! Klicka här för att öppna pdfx v1.9 webbverktyget som konverterar PDF-filer till XML och HTML.
Du kan konvertera kalkylark-PDF-filer till XML med det verktyget genom att trycka på knappen Välj fil . Välj sedan PDF-kalkylbladet som du sparat från Google Sheets. Tryck på knappen Skicka för att konvertera PDF till XML. Sedan kan du öppna kalkylarket i XML- eller HTML-format. Klicka på xml för att öppna filen i XML-format som visas i ögonblicksbilden nedan.
Sedan kan du öppna XML från den mapp du sparat den med lämplig textredigeringsprogram eller Excel eller vilket annat verktyg du föredrar. Du kan öppna XML med textredigerare som Notepad ++, som är ett av de bästa anteckningsboken från tredje part som täcks i detta Tech Junkie-inlägg. Alternativt kan du kolla in den här sidan och trycka på knappen Bläddra där för att öppna den med XML Viewer, som innehåller en trädvy för att visa XML-ingång som visas i ögonblicksbilden nedan.
Konvertera kalkylark till XML med tillägget Export Sheet Data
Exportera och konvertera är lite tråkigt, särskilt om du har ett dussin (eller värre, hundra) kalkylark att konvertera. Google Sheets har en mängd tillägg som lägger till nya alternativ och verktyg. Export Sheet Data är ett tillägg som gör det möjligt för användare att exportera enstaka ark eller hela kalkylark till antingen XML- eller JSON-format, så att du kan exportera Google-kalkylark till XML med det tillägget istället för att ladda ner och konvertera dem till formatet.
Öppna först den här sidan och tryck på knappen Lägg till där för att installera tillägget Export Sheet Data. Öppna sedan ett kalkylblad i Google Sheets och klicka på Tillägg för att öppna en meny som innehåller Export Sheet Data . Välj Exportera arkdata > Öppna sidofält för att öppna sidofältet som visas i ögonblicksbilden direkt nedan.
Nu kan du klicka på menyn Välj format för att välja att konvertera kalkylarket till antingen XML- eller JSON-format. Klicka på Välj ark för att välja att konvertera alla ark i kalkylarket eller bara det aktuella arket. Eller så kan du välja Anpassad för att välja mer specifika ark som ska konverteras. Om du bläddrar ner i sidofältet kan du välja ytterligare XML-alternativ för att justera formateringen. Tryck på Visualisera- knappen längst ner i sidofältet för att öppna en förhandsvisning av XML-filen innan du exporterar den.
Tryck på Export- knappen för att sammanställa kalkylarket till XML-format. Därefter öppnas ett Exportfönster med en länk till kalkylark XML. Klicka på länken för att öppna kalkylarket XML i webbläsaren som visas i ögonblicksbilden nedan. Du kan trycka på nedladdningsknappen där för att spara kalkylark XML i en hårddiskmapp.
Klicka på knappen Fler åtgärder för ytterligare alternativ. Sedan kan du välja att dela XML genom att klicka på Dela . Eller välj Lägg till stjärna så att du kan komma åt XML-kalkylarket snabbare i Google Drive.
Med Export Sheet Data kan Google Sheets kunna exportera ark som XML på ett öppet och enkelt sätt. Med det tillägget kan du snabbt exportera dina Google-kalkylark till XML utan att spara och konvertera dem till XML.